Output 7496d15f3cab23c5142e3fc034e819997645071d028818a5245a488ebb611748:6

value
69354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d12f75ba1b215ca4c3c7a09c424150435507fbb OP_EQUAL
address
32t9RqPfp43yRvR8uYnnQCd5QNKfsXFBW2
transaction
7496d15f3cab23c5142e3fc034e819997645071d028818a5245a488ebb611748
spent
true